Court: US border agents can search phones without warrant
The US Court of Appeals for the Second Circuit ruled that border patrol agents can search travelers' mobile phones without a warrant, without reasonable suspicion, or probable cause. The ruling applies to all those entering United States territory. The decision raises serious concerns about privacy and civil rights.
